In the recent notification, Narmada Hydroelectric Development Corporation, Madhya Pradesh has announced a recruitment drive for 21 vacant posts of Apprentice. An official notification in this regard can be downloaded from the NHDC website, nhdcindia.com. As per the notification, the recruitment is announced for Graduate apprentice, Diploma/ Technical Apprentice and Technician (Vocational)/ ITI Apprentice. Applications from eligible candidates can only be submitted by September 25, 2020.
Out of the total 21 vacancies, 05 vacancies are announced for Graduate Apprentice, 05 vacancies for Diploma/ Technical Apprentice and 10 vacancies for Technician (Vocational)/ ITI Apprentice. Selected applicants for the respective apprenticeship gets training at Indira Sagar Power Station. Graduate Apprentices gets a monthly stipend of Rs. 9000/-, Technical/ Diploma Apprentice gets Rs. 8000;/- and Technician (Vocational)/ ITI Apprentice receives Rs. 7000/-.
Applicants intending to apply for Graduate Apprentice posts must have Bachelors degree (BE/ B. Tech) in Engineering with a minimum of 70% marks for General/ OBC and 60% marks for SC/ ST candidates. To apply for Diploma/ Technical Apprentice post a diploma in relevant engineering branch is mandatory. Candidates who have passed 10th class can apply for Technician (Vocational)/ ITI Apprentice. In addition, they must have passed the National Trade Certificate Examination (NTC) or State Certificate Certificate Examination (STC) from ITI. Degree/ Diploma/ ITI acquired from distance or correspondence education system is not eligible for this recruitment.
Candidate’s age should not exceed as that prescribed by the conducting body. The minimum age limit for all the categories is 18 years. For General Category, the upper age limit is 25 years. The maximum age limit is relaxable for SC/ ST category up to 05 years, OBC (NCL) for 03 years, Physically Handicap persons is 10 years. An additional 05 years is relaxable for NHDC regular employees.
Interested and eligible applicants who wish to apply for the announced post can apply through online apprenticeship portal, apprenticeship.gov.in. Those who are applying for Graduate and Technical/ Diploma Apprentice can apply through BOAR website postal, mhrdnats.gov.in. Once candidates are done with the form submission, they have to submit self-attested copies of the following documents – proof of date of birth, documents in support to educational qualification, Madhya Pradesh domicile certificate valid caste certificate, self-undertaking for OBC (NCL), copy of employee certificate. The documents should be sent to ‘The Deputy General Manager (HR), NHDC Indira Sagar Power Station, Narmada Nagar District Khandwa (MP) Pin 450119’.
Once the application procedure is completed, NHDC scrutinizes the submitted application forms. Based on the eligible applicants, the selection process for Graduate/ Diploma/ ITI apprentice is decided. Applications sent by wards of NHDC cadre employees are considered separately.
